I'm trying to understand this simple problem but I can't understand...

my security files:

/layers.properties
#Tue Aug 10 12:11:48 CEST 2010
irpi.rain_gauge_network.r=ROLE_TEST
mode=CHALLENGE

/users.properties
#Tue Aug 10 12:11:28 CEST 2010
user=XXXXX,ROLE_WFS_READ,enabled
XXXX=XXXXX,ROLE_ADMINISTRATOR,enabled
test=test-test,ROLE_TEST,enabled

/services.properties 
#Tue Aug 10 12:12:03 CEST 2010

I have around 100 layers into geoserver.
I'm using Udig to test this configuration. 

- when I call my wfs server from udig I can see all the layers (it is
normal?? may be this is related to CHALLENGE..)
- when I ask with udig (getfeature) for a layer different from the one
written into the layers.properties I obtain a user and password window.
If I don't give username and password and I press cancel the map
appears! I suppose it shouldn't.. 
- if, on the opposite, I try to give the correct username and password I
still obtain another login window.. and so on
